Dispensing Machine Sealing Ring

Updated: 2026-07-31

Overview

Dispensing machine sealing rings are specialized gaskets designed to create leak-proof seals in automated fluid dispensing systems. These components are essential for maintaining process accuracy and preventing waste in industries like electronics manufacturing, automotive assembly, and medical device production. Typically installed in syringe barrels, valves, or nozzle connections, sealing rings endure repeated compression cycles while resisting chemical degradation. Their performance directly impacts equipment longevity and product consistency, making material selection and dimensional precision critical for industrial applications.

Structure and Working Principle

Standard sealing rings for dispensing machines feature an O-ring or custom cross-section design that deforms under compression to fill microscopic gaps between mating surfaces. The elastic recovery force of the rubber material maintains constant sealing pressure even during equipment vibration or thermal expansion. Advanced variants may incorporate spring energizers for high-pressure systems (up to 10,000 psi) or PTFE jackets for low-friction applications. The sealing mechanism relies on proper gland design—typically following AS568 or ISO 3601 standards—to achieve optimal compression (usually 15-30%) without causing extrusion damage.

Key Features

High-performance sealing rings offer broad chemical compatibility, with FKM rings resisting oils and solvents while silicone handles extreme temperatures (-60°C to 230°C). Modern materials like FFKM (perfluoroelastomer) provide universal chemical resistance for semiconductor-grade applications. Low compression set (≤15% after prolonged use) ensures consistent sealing force over time. Some manufacturers integrate conductive fillers to prevent static buildup in explosive environments. For abrasive fluids, composite designs with wear-resistant faces extend service life by 3-5x compared to standard rubber rings.

Application Areas

Primary applications include precision adhesive dispensing in PCB assembly, underfill encapsulation, and surface mount technology (SMT). Medical device manufacturers use USP Class VI-certified rings for biopharmaceutical dispensing. In heavy industries, large-diameter seals (up to 500mm) serve in robotic sealant applicators for automotive windshields. Food-grade variants comply with FDA 21 CFR 177.2600 for packaging machinery. Specialized low-outgassing rings are critical in aerospace composite layup processes.

Maintenance and Precautions

Routine inspection should check for flattening, cracks, or swelling—indicators requiring immediate replacement. Always clean mating surfaces before installation to prevent particulate-induced leaks. Use silicone-based lubricants sparingly for NBR rings; PTFE spray works better for FKM. Store unused seals away from ozone sources and sunlight at 15-25°C. For CIP (clean-in-place) systems, verify chemical compatibility with sterilization agents like hydrogen peroxide vapor. Maintain spare part inventories based on mean time between failures (MTBF) data from equipment manufacturers.

B2B Procurement Guide

Industrial buyers should specify: 1) Fluid type and concentration, 2) Continuous operating temperature range, 3) Dynamic vs static application, 4) Regulatory requirements (e.g., RoHS, REACH). Bulk purchases (500+ units) typically offer 20-35% cost savings. Consider vendor certifications like ISO 9001 and ISO 14001. For custom sizes, lead times average 4-8 weeks. Some suppliers provide finite element analysis (FEA) reports to validate seal performance under projected operating conditions.
